I echo what TC said - You have to decide what you want.
Do you want performance (TQ & HP)?
Do you want looks - Tru Duals?
Or, do you want quite?
If you want quite, I would not suggest the two into one performance pipes or any of the TruDuals (V&H or Rinehart). If keeping it on the quite side is your main objective, you will probably want to keep your stock header pipes and change to different slip-on mufflers. Which slip-on mufflers?.... I suggest looking around and listening to other mufflers. You don't want to spent $$$ and then be unhappy with your purchase.
I have V&H Big Shot Duals. They were a little too loud for me until I changes to the quite baffles and added fish-tail tips (the tips did make a difference in the tone). They sound awesome now IMO, but would probably be too loud for you.
Get out and go on a few poker runs and toy runs (since Christmas is coming up quick). Look and listen.
